Step 1: Assessment and Planning

Our team will arrive quickly and assess the damage, identifying the source of the water and the extent of the damage. We’ll develop a customized plan to address the issue, and we’ll explain the process to you in detail.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use advanced equipment to extract the water from your property, reducing the risk of further damage and costly repairs. Our team will work efficiently to get the water out, and we’ll dry your property quickly to prevent mold and mildew growth.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We’ll use specialized equipment to dry your property, including dehumidifiers and air movers. Our team will work to remove any remaining moisture, ensuring your property is safe and dry.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

We’ll thoroughly clean and sanitize your property, removing any dirt, grime, or bacteria that may have accumulated during the water damage. Our team will use eco-friendly cleaning products and equipment to ensure a safe and healthy environment.

Step 5: Reconstruction and Repair

Once the cleaning and sanitizing process is complete, our team will begin the reconstruction and repair process. We’ll work with you to restore your property to its original condition, using high-quality materials and expert craftsmanship.

Residential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ak in a bathroom or kitchen Yes No DIY fixes are usually simple and inexpensive.
Water damage from a burst pipe No Yes Professional help is needed to prevent further damage and ensure a safe environment.
Flooding in a basement or crawl space No Yes Professional equipment and expertise are necessary to extract water and prevent mold growth.
Water stains on walls and ceilings No Yes Professional help is needed to identify and address the source of the water damage.
Discoloration or warping of wood No Yes Professional help is needed to assess and repair any structural damage.
Musty odors or mold growth No Yes Professional help is needed to safely and effectively remove mold and mildew.

Residential Water Damage Restoration Cost in Poulsbo, WA

The cost of Residential Water Damage Restoration can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ions in Poulsbo, WA. These estimates are based on typical scenarios and may vary depending on your specific situation.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ction and Dr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local labor costs
Cleaning and Sanitizing $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of materials damaged, and local labor costs
Reconstruction and Repair $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of materials needed, and local labor costs
Dehumidification and Air Movers $100 – $500 Size of affected area and local labor costs
Mold Remediation $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of mold, and local labor costs
Insurance Claims Help $0 – $500 Complexity of claim and local labor costs
